400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> 软件攻略 > 文章详情

微信小程序怎么制作照片(微信小程序照片制作)

作者:路由通
|
258人看过
发布时间:2025-06-01 04:40:58
标签:
微信小程序照片制作全方位指南 在数字化浪潮中,微信小程序因其便捷性成为照片制作的重要平台。通过小程序,用户无需专业设备或复杂软件,即可快速完成从拍摄到后期处理的全流程操作。照片制作类小程序往往集成了丰富的模板、滤镜和编辑工具,满足日常社交
微信小程序怎么制作照片(微信小程序照片制作)

<>

微信小程序照片制作全方位指南



在数字化浪潮中,微信小程序因其便捷性成为照片制作的重要平台。通过小程序,用户无需专业设备或复杂软件,即可快速完成从拍摄到后期处理的全流程操作。照片制作类小程序往往集成了丰富的模板、滤镜和编辑工具,满足日常社交、商业宣传等多样化需求。小程序的低开发门槛也吸引了大量开发者入局,形成了从基础工具到垂直领域的完整生态链。本文将从八个关键维度系统解析微信小程序照片制作的完整解决方案,涵盖技术实现、功能设计、用户体验等核心环节。

微	信小程序怎么制作照片

一、开发环境与技术选型


搭建微信小程序照片制作功能首先需要注册开发者账号并安装微信开发者工具。开发语言采用WXML+WXSS+JavaScript组合,其中:


  • WXML负责页面结构搭建

  • WXSS用于样式设计

  • JavaScript处理核心业务逻辑


照片处理涉及的核心技术对比:






























技术方案 处理速度 兼容性 开发复杂度
Canvas原生API 较快 全平台支持 中等
WebGL 最快 部分机型限制
第三方SDK 依赖网络 需授权

实际开发中建议采用分层架构:基础功能使用Canvas实现,高级特效可集成腾讯云AI等PaaS服务。需特别注意iOS与Android系统对图片格式处理的差异,建议统一转换为JPG格式再进行后续操作。

二、核心功能模块设计


完整的照片制作小程序应包含以下功能模块:


  • 图像采集模块:支持相机直接拍摄和相册导入双通道

  • 基础编辑模块:裁剪、旋转、亮度/对比度调节等基础工具

  • 特效处理模块:提供滤镜、贴纸、文字添加等创意功能


功能实现深度对比:






























功能类型 用户使用频率 实现成本 技术难点
智能抠图 58% 边缘识别算法
人脸美化 72% 特征点检测
艺术滤镜 89% 色彩矩阵运算

建议采用模块化开发方式,每个功能对应独立JS文件。对于计算密集型操作如图片压缩,应使用Worker线程避免界面卡顿。

三、UI/UX设计规范


照片制作类小程序的界面设计需遵循以下原则:


  • 操作路径不超过3层

  • 主要编辑工具置于底部固定栏

  • 实时预览区域占比不低于60%


主流小程序UI布局对比:






























设计风格 工具可见性 学习成本 用户评分
抽屉式导航 较低 3.8/5
平铺式布局 4.2/5
混合式设计 4.5/5

色彩方案推荐使用浅色背景+高饱和度功能按钮的组合,关键操作按钮直径应不小于88px以确保点击精度。动画过渡时间控制在300ms内符合用户心理预期。

四、性能优化策略


照片处理对小程序性能提出严峻挑战,需重点关注:


  • 内存管理:及时释放不再使用的图片对象

  • 渲染优化:对Canvas进行分层绘制

  • 加载策略:采用渐进式图片加载


不同尺寸图片的处理性能数据:






























图片分辨率 加载时间 处理耗时 内存占用
800×600 0.8s 1.2s 45MB
1920×1080 2.5s 3.8s 210MB
4000×3000 6.2s 9.5s 720MB

建议对上传图片进行自动压缩,阈值设置为1500px宽度为宜。可使用微信的CDN加速图片分发,对频繁使用的素材包实施本地缓存策略。

五、模板系统构建


预制模板能显著降低用户创作门槛,模板库建设要点包括:


  • 节日热点模板实时更新

  • 支持用户自定义模板保存

  • 建立模板分类标签系统


模板类型使用数据分析:






























模板类别 使用占比 付费转化率 平均制作时长
生日祝福 32% 18% 2.3分钟
电商海报 25% 35% 4.1分钟
旅行相册 19% 12% 3.7分钟

技术实现上可采用JSON描述模板结构,包含图层顺序、元素定位等元数据。建议开发可视化模板编辑器供设计师使用,输出标准格式的模板配置文件。

六、社交分享机制


微信生态内照片作品的传播需注意:


  • 生成专属分享封面图

  • 嵌入小程序路径二维码

  • 设计裂变式分享奖励


不同分享渠道效果对比:






























分享方式 打开率 转化率 用户获取成本
单聊分享 65% 28% 0.8元
群聊分享 42% 15% 0.3元
朋友圈 18% 9% 1.2元

需调用wx.showShareMenu开启转发功能,自定义分享内容时应包含作品预览图。建议设置分享数据埋点,追踪不同模板的传播效果。

七、商业化路径设计


照片制作小程序的盈利模式主要有:


  • 高级功能订阅制

  • 定制模板付费下载

  • 品牌广告植入


变现模式收益对比:






























商业模式 ARPU值 用户接受度 技术实现难度
VIP会员 15元/月 中等
单次付费 2-5元/次
广告分成 0.3元/千次

付费功能设计需把握免费与付费的平衡点,建议基础编辑功能免费,艺术字体、高级滤镜等增值服务收费。接入微信支付时要注意处理支付中断的异常场景。

八、数据安全与合规


用户照片处理涉及敏感数据,必须建立完善的安全机制:


  • 图片上传使用HTTPS加密

  • 用户数据本地存储加密

  • 明确隐私政策告知义务


各平台数据规范对比:






























合规要求 微信标准 行业基准 国际规范
数据保留期限 90天 依需而定
人脸数据使用 明示授权 默认可用 严格限制
未成年保护 强制年龄门 自愿设置 分级制度

建议在首次使用时弹出隐私协议弹窗,关键数据操作如人脸识别需单独获取授权。服务器端应定期进行安全审计,防范SQL注入等网络攻击。

微	信小程序怎么制作照片

微信小程序照片制作功能的持续优化需要紧密结合用户反馈与数据指标。通过A/B测试验证不同交互设计的转化效果,技术团队应保持对微信新API的关注,如最近推出的WebGPU支持可以大幅提升图像处理效率。运营方面建议建立模板设计师社区,通过UGC内容不断丰富素材库。安全合规领域要特别注意《个人信息保护法》实施后的监管要求,在用户体验与数据安全间找到最佳平衡点。随着AR、AI技术的普及,下一代照片制作小程序将整合更多智能交互元素,如基于手势识别的实时修图、AI构图建议等创新功能。



相关文章
微信密码丢失如何找回(微信密码找回)
微信密码丢失如何找回?全方位深度解析 微信作为国内最大的社交平台之一,密码丢失可能影响用户通信、支付及数据安全。找回密码需结合账号绑定状态、设备验证、人工审核等多重因素,不同场景下操作流程差异显著。本文将从设备验证、手机号绑定、邮箱辅助、
2025-06-01 04:40:56
210人看过
视频号是怎么弄的(视频号创建方法)
视频号全方位运营攻略 视频号综合评述 视频号作为微信生态的核心内容载体,已成为公私域流量联动的重要节点。其独特的社交分发机制和商业化闭环设计,让创作者能够通过内容直接触达12亿微信用户。相较于抖音、快手等平台,视频号在用户画像覆盖广度和转
2025-06-01 04:40:40
272人看过
手机怎么加自己的微信("自己微信加手机")
手机添加自己微信的全面指南 在现代社交生活中,微信已成为不可或缺的通讯工具。许多人可能从未想过"手机怎么加自己的微信"这个问题,但实际上这一操作在特定场景下具有实用价值。比如更换设备时需要重新登录、管理多个账号、测试功能或备份数据时,都可
2025-06-01 04:40:43
201人看过
ps如何提取线稿图(PS提取线稿)
Photoshop线稿提取全方位攻略 在数字绘画和平面设计领域,线稿提取是基础却至关重要的技术环节。Photoshop作为行业标准工具,提供了从简单阈值调整到复杂通道运算的多元化解决方案。不同于单一方法通吃所有场景,实际工作中需要根据原始
2025-06-01 04:40:21
395人看过
如何自主建设微信商城(自建微信商城)
微信商城自主建设全方位指南 在数字化转型浪潮中,微信商城已成为企业私域流量变现的核心阵地。自主建设微信商城不仅能降低运营成本,还能实现用户数据深度挖掘与精准营销。不同于第三方SaaS平台,自主开发需要从资质申请、技术选型、支付对接、商品管
2025-06-01 04:40:08
382人看过
微信怎么可以连续转发(微信连续转发方法)
微信连续转发全方位攻略 微信作为国内最大的社交平台之一,其转发功能在日常沟通和信息传播中扮演着重要角色。然而,许多用户对如何实现连续转发存在困惑。连续转发不仅能提升信息传递效率,还能扩大内容影响力。本文将深入探讨微信连续转发的实现方法、限
2025-06-01 04:40:08
192人看过